Lettore di schede SD non rilevato in Ubuntu 16.04


34

Di recente ho aggiornato a Ubuntu 16.04 e il mio lettore di schede SD non funziona. Il sistema non rileva affatto il lettore. L'output di lsusbè abbastanza disinformativo:

lsusb
Bus 001 Device 002: ID 8087:8000 Intel Corp. 
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 003 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 002 Device 005: ID 8087:07dc Intel Corp. 
Bus 002 Device 004: ID 0bda:572a Realtek Semiconductor Corp. 
Bus 002 Device 003: ID 046d:c245 Logitech, Inc. G400 Optical Mouse
Bus 002 Device 002: ID 04f3:024c Elan Microelectronics Corp. 
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ub

Quindi non so nemmeno quale modello di lettore di schede SD abbia. Sto usando un ideapad u430.

Uscita di lspci:

00:00.0 Host bridge: Intel Corporation Haswell-ULT DRAM Controller (rev 0b)
00:02.0 VGA compatible controller: Intel Corporation Haswell-ULT Integrated Graphics Controller (rev 0b)
00:03.0 Audio device: Intel Corporation Haswell-ULT HD Audio Controller (rev 0b)
00:14.0 USB controller: Intel Corporation 8 Series USB xHCI HC (rev 04)
00:16.0 Communication controller: Intel Corporation 8 Series HECI #0 (rev 04)
00:1b.0 Audio device: Intel Corporation 8 Series HD Audio Controller (rev 04)
00:1c.0 PCI bridge: Intel Corporation 8 Series PCI Express Root Port 1 (rev e4)
00:1c.2 PCI bridge: Intel Corporation 8 Series PCI Express Root Port 3 (rev e4)
00:1c.3 PCI bridge: Intel Corporation 8 Series PCI Express Root Port 4 (rev e4)
00:1c.4 PCI bridge: Intel Corporation 8 Series PCI Express Root Port 5 (rev e4)
00:1d.0 USB controller: Intel Corporation 8 Series USB EHCI #1 (rev 04)
00:1f.0 ISA bridge: Intel Corporation 8 Series LPC Controller (rev 04)
00:1f.2 SATA controller: Intel Corporation 8 Series SATA Controller 1 [AHCI mode] (rev 04)
00:1f.3 SMBus: Intel Corporation 8 Series SMBus Controller (rev 04)
01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8111/8168/8411 PCI Express Gigabit Ethernet Controller (rev 10)
02:00.0 Network controller: Intel Corporation Wireless 7260 (rev 73)
09:00.0 3D controller: NVIDIA Corporation GK208M [GeForce GT 730M] (rev a1)

Hai provato a inserire una scheda SD nel lettore? Con alcuni lettori di schede di memoria il collegamento tramite IDE o Sata all'interno del laptop e non è possibile rilevare effettivamente senza la scheda SD presente.
proprocastinatore

Potrebbe anche essere pci, nel qual caso "lspci" sarebbe il comando per trovarlo.
proprocastinatore

si, l'ho provato con una sdcard nel lettore, non cambia nulla: /
Matías Guzmán Naranjo

Ho appena aggiunto l'output di lspci
Matías Guzmán Naranjo il

Prova ad avviare un CD Linux completamente diverso dal vivo, ad esempio Fedora, Manjaro o simili e controlla se il lettore funziona lì. Giusto, sai che non sai se è un problema hardware o software. Se il lettore funziona su un altro sistema operativo / Live CD, è in qualche modo chiaro che si tratta di un problema di software.
dufte,

Risposte:


55

Probabilmente un problema di installazione che può essere risolto con la reinstallazione ?! Ciò riguarderebbe il pacchetto udisks2.

  1. Reinstallare il pacchettoudisks2

    sudo apt-get install --reinstall udisks2
    
  2. Riavvia la macchina

    systemctl reboot
    

Le schede SD devono quindi essere riconosciute, dopo averle inserite (dentro e fuori e con cautela).


sorprendentemente questo ha funzionato su Toshiba. Su questo laptop la scheda SD ha funzionato nelle precedenti versioni di Ubuntu e si è fermata nel 17.04.
culebrón,

1
Risolto anche il mio problema con il lettore di schede SD!
postfuturista il

Spacchi. Grazie!
nweiler,

@nweiler - è buono - ma io non comando ... non ho talento come AH.
dschinn1001,

1

Immagino tu abbia un lettore di schede Realtek?

Scarica il driver Linux per il tuo dispositivo Realtek, ad esempio rts5159 Apri una nuova sessione di terminale

Installa il driver. Esegui i seguenti comandi:

cd where-your-driver-was-downloaded-extracted 
make
sudo make install
sudo depmod

Sembra che il sito Realtek abbia rimosso tutti i file relativi ai driver solo due rimanenti di cose nuove.
Pablo A

0

Se hai installato un lettore di schede lsusbdovrebbe darti qualcosa del tipo:

Bus 001 Device 005: ID 0bda:0129 Realtek Semiconductor Corp. RTS5129 Card Reader Controller
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.